Primary Responsibilities

  • Advance the mission and purpose of NYCON through the following:
    • Participate in policy-setting
    • Contribute to discussion and decision-making
    • Engage in strategic planning, assisting with implementing and monitoring annual goals
  • Fiduciary oversight
  • Review, sign, and fully adhere to NYCON's code of conduct and conflict of interest policies.
  • Be an active member of the Board, including:
    • Make every effort to attend at least 75% of five regularly scheduled Board meetings.
    • Attend the Annual Meeting each October and Board Retreat each December.
    • Actively participate in at least one Board committee.
    • Help build an effective Board through recruiting potential Board nominees with professional expertise and reputational capital who can make significant contributions to the work of NYCON.
    • Secure financial resources for NYCON. Each Board member will prioritize NYCON in their charitable giving by contributing to the Annual Board Campaign at a personally significant level and engaging in resource development and stewardship efforts.
    • Serve as an ambassador and an advocate for NYCON through the following:
      • Speak positively of the organization to current and potential stakeholders and constituencies
      • Attend and promote NYCON events
      • Amplify NYCON content online

    Term

    Board members serve 3-year terms, with no more than 3 consecutive full terms. Board members are elected by Membership at the October Annual Meeting and take their official voting seat on January 1. Board members-elect are expected to attend board meetings and committee meetings between their election and January in a non-voting capacity.
